MINEOLA, N.Y. – Nassau County District Attorney Madeline Singas announced that a Queens man was arraigned on a grand jury indictment today for allegedly raping three women in three separate attacks between 2015 and 2020.
Adell Hardwick, 32, of Hollis, was arraigned today before Judge Robert McDonald and charged with two counts of predatory sexual assault (an A-II felony), three counts of rape in the first degree (a B violent felony) and three counts of criminal sexual act in the first degree (a B violent felony). The defendant was remanded and is due back in court on September 10. If convicted of all counts, he faces a maximum of 125 years to life in prison.
“Adell Hardwick allegedly preyed upon three women on the streets of Hempstead and brutally raped them,” said DA Singas. “These vicious attacks, which occurred between 2015 and 2020, are the marks of a serial predator. Thanks to DNA matches on all three cases, we will aggressively seek justice for these women. Nassau County is safer now that this defendant is apprehended.”
DA Singas said that on the evening of January 29, 2020, the female victim was leaving a local business and was allegedly approached from behind by the defendant who displayed a knife and brought her to an abandoned house on Hilton Avenue in Hempstead, where he allegedly raped and sodomized her.
On June 4, 2019, at approximately 6:00 pm, a second female victim was inside Denton Green Park in Hempstead when she was allegedly approached by the defendant, who allegedly pushed her toward a tree and raped and sodomized her.
On January 25, 2015, at approximately 9:00 pm, a now-deceased third female victim was walking on Main Street in Hempstead when she was allegedly attacked by the defendant and dragged to an abandoned house where she was allegedly forcibly raped and sodomized by the defendant.
NCPD Detectives arrested the defendant on April 23, 2020, following a re-examination of the cases after the defendant’s DNA matched the victims mentioned above.
Deputy Bureau Chief of DA Singas’ Major Offense Bureau Jared Rosenblatt, Senior Assistant District Attorney Stephanie Hernan of the County Court Trial Bureau and Assistant District Attorney Kevin Sheehan of the Special Victims Bureau are prosecuting this case. The defendant is represented by Glenn Hardy, Esq.
The charges are merely accusations, and the defendant is presumed innocent until and unless found guilty.
